Agencies Add Session for MAP-21 Phone Forum
September 21, 2012 (PLANSPONSOR.com) – The Internal Revenue Service (IRS) and Pension Benefit Guaranty Corporation (PBGC) announced that the September 27 phone forum about MAP-21 and changing segment rates is full.

A 2:00 p.m. EST session has been added for the Moving Ahead for Progress in the 21st Century Act (MAP-21) phone forum (see “Agencies to Hold MAP-21 Phone Forum”).
Mike Spaid and Tony Montanaro, actuaries with the IRS, and Amy Viener, actuary with the PBGC, will host the forum.
